Overview

IZARD CO. CONS. HIGH SCHOOL is a public high serving grades 9–12 in BROCKWELL, Arkansas. The school enrolls 191 students. It is part of the IZARD COUNTY CONSOLIDATED SCHOOL DISTRICT district.

Equity & Title I

In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
